From 44fa9c4ce0df6da99f71fc34e366444ffbdf6be6 Mon Sep 17 00:00:00 2001 From: M66B Date: Mon, 1 Jul 2019 15:55:15 +0200 Subject: [PATCH] A matter of focus --- app/src/main/java/eu/faircode/email/FragmentCompose.java | 7 ------- .../main/java/eu/faircode/email/FragmentIdentity.java | 9 --------- app/src/main/res/layout/dialog_insert_link.xml | 5 ++++- app/src/main/res/layout/dialog_keyword.xml | 5 ++++- app/src/main/res/layout/dialog_open_link.xml | 5 ++++- app/src/main/res/layout/dialog_password.xml | 5 ++++- app/src/main/res/layout/fragment_quick_setup.xml | 5 ++++- 7 files changed, 20 insertions(+), 21 deletions(-) diff --git a/app/src/main/java/eu/faircode/email/FragmentCompose.java b/app/src/main/java/eu/faircode/email/FragmentCompose.java index eec852c45b..0a29a2f2fe 100644 --- a/app/src/main/java/eu/faircode/email/FragmentCompose.java +++ b/app/src/main/java/eu/faircode/email/FragmentCompose.java @@ -3409,13 +3409,6 @@ public class FragmentCompose extends FragmentBase { else etLink.setText(savedInstanceState.getString("fair:link")); - new Handler().post(new Runnable() { - @Override - public void run() { - etLink.requestFocus(); - } - }); - return new AlertDialog.Builder(getContext()) .setView(view) .setPositiveButton(android.R.string.ok, new DialogInterface.OnClickListener() { diff --git a/app/src/main/java/eu/faircode/email/FragmentIdentity.java b/app/src/main/java/eu/faircode/email/FragmentIdentity.java index 308b75c8d2..16c64b7ed9 100644 --- a/app/src/main/java/eu/faircode/email/FragmentIdentity.java +++ b/app/src/main/java/eu/faircode/email/FragmentIdentity.java @@ -853,8 +853,6 @@ public class FragmentIdentity extends FragmentBase { color = (identity == null || identity.color == null ? Color.TRANSPARENT : identity.color); - etName.requestFocus(); - if (identity == null) new SimpleTask() { @Override @@ -1110,13 +1108,6 @@ public class FragmentIdentity extends FragmentBase { etHtml = dview.findViewById(R.id.etHtml); etHtml.setText(html); - new Handler().post(new Runnable() { - @Override - public void run() { - etHtml.requestFocus(); - } - }); - return new AlertDialog.Builder(getContext()) .setTitle(R.string.title_edit_html) .setView(dview) diff --git a/app/src/main/res/layout/dialog_insert_link.xml b/app/src/main/res/layout/dialog_insert_link.xml index 9e70186a1c..4f0b81a486 100644 --- a/app/src/main/res/layout/dialog_insert_link.xml +++ b/app/src/main/res/layout/dialog_insert_link.xml @@ -26,7 +26,10 @@ android:text="https://email.faircode.eu/" android:textAppearance="@style/TextAppearance.AppCompat.Small" app:layout_constraintStart_toStartOf="parent" - app:layout_constraintTop_toBottomOf="@id/tvOpenLink" /> + app:layout_constraintTop_toBottomOf="@id/tvOpenLink"> + + + + app:layout_constraintTop_toBottomOf="@id/tvKeyword"> + + + \ No newline at end of file diff --git a/app/src/main/res/layout/dialog_open_link.xml b/app/src/main/res/layout/dialog_open_link.xml index dd4e19945d..722a5aceba 100644 --- a/app/src/main/res/layout/dialog_open_link.xml +++ b/app/src/main/res/layout/dialog_open_link.xml @@ -37,7 +37,10 @@ android:text="https://email.faircode.eu/" android:textAppearance="@style/TextAppearance.AppCompat.Small" app:layout_constraintStart_toStartOf="parent" - app:layout_constraintTop_toBottomOf="@id/tvTitle" /> + app:layout_constraintTop_toBottomOf="@id/tvTitle"> + + + + android:textAppearance="@style/TextAppearance.AppCompat.Medium"> + + + + app:layout_constraintTop_toTopOf="parent"> + + +